3 GOP senators vying for leader role

All have endorsements from party allies

By: Riley Beggin
USA Today

WASHINGTON - President-elect Donald Trump's allies are adding their voices - and pressure - to Wednesday's [11/13/2024] high-stakes election to pick Republican leader Mitch McConnell's heir, who will pay a major role in the incoming administration's vision for the country.
..... McConnell - the longest-serving Senate party leader in American history - is steeping down form his leadership post in January. [2025] Three senators are running to replace him in an election that will take place behind closed doors.
..... Trump allied Tucker Carlson, Vivek Ramanswamy, Elon Musk, Robert F. Kennedy Jr. and others are weighing in on the critical vote for the next Senate Republican leader, serving as a potent reminder that every major decision is ripe for influence in Trump's Washington.
..... The only question now is whether it will work.
..... Two senators are considered the main contenders: South Dakota's John Thune, who is currently second-in-command in the Senate GOP as Republican whip and Texas' John Cornyn, who has also served as whip and previously led the Senate GOP's campaign arm. Both have longstanding relationship with McConnell.
..... But several of Trump's most recognized allies are mounting a campaign to choose Florida's Rick Scott. They argue Scott is the only candidate who has been sufficiently loyal to Trump and would be best equipped to represent the president-elect interests. Some are poking at a yearlong rivalry between Trump and McConnell that flared up after the capitol riot in January 6, 2021.
..... A vote for Rick Scott is a vote to END the anti-Trump rot of Mitch McConnell in the US Senate,: conservative podcaster Benny Johnson posted on X. "Thune and Cornyn are a continuation of McConnell's total failure."
..... Also on social media, Carlson accused Cornyn's positions of being "indistinguishable from Liz Cheney's," one of Trump's most vocal critics. Kennedy responded to Carlson's post, sharing, "without Rick Scott, the entire Trump reform agenda wobbly."
..... Thune and Cornyn have been active fundraisers and campaigners for their fellow senators and are popular with their colleagues. Thier supporters say they would bring decades of experience to the leadership role and could hit the ground running to enact Trump's agenda.
..... Both Republican senators have worked to rebuild their relationship with the president-elect and say they stand ready to pursue his goals, including a recent demand too accelerate confirmation of his Cabinet and judicial nominees.
..... On Sunday, [11/10/2024] Trump rote on Truth Social: "any Republican Senator seeking the covered LEADERSHIP position in the United States Senate must agree to Recess Appointments (in the Senate!), without which we will not be able to get people confirmed in a timely manner."
..... By demanding "recess appointments," he asking the leaders to agree to dismiss the chamber to allow him to appoint temporary nominees without lengthy confirmation battles. He also insisted Republicans prevent Democrats from confirming any more judges while President Joe Biden is in office.
..... All three candidates moved quickly to show their support for the idea.
..... Trump has not publicly indicated who he plans to endorse in the three-way Senate race, which will be conducted by secret ballot. A public pressure campaign is a gamble: It could change the direction of the race, or senators might reject Trump;s choice.
..... Thune, 63, was first elected to the Senate in 2004. As the Republican whip, he is responsible for ensuring his party has enough votes to accomplish its goals in the upper chamber.
..... After January 6, 2021, Thune was among the many senators in both parties who condemned the rioters and opposed Trump's efforts to overturn the 2020 presidential election results. Trump then called for someone to challenge Thune in his 2020 primary, but no one emerged, and Thune prevailed.
..... Thune initially endorse Senator Tim Scott, R-North Carolina, in the 2024 GOP primary, but later endorse Trump after Scott dropped out. in the moths since, Thune has worked to repair his connection with Trump, including visiting the president-elect's Mar-a-Lago resort in Palm Beach, Florida.
..... Still Thune on CNBC last weekend [11-09-10/2024] urged the president-elect not to "exert" influence over the Senate leadership election.
..... Many senators are playing their cards close to their chest ahead of Wednesday's [11/13/202] vote. But Thune has three public endorsements so far: Senators Steve Daines, R-Montana, National Republican Senatorial Committee chair; Mike Rounds, R-South Dakota, and Markwayne Mullin, R-Oklahoma.
..... Corny, 72, has served in the SE ante since 2002. He was the GOP whip before Thune and chair of the NRSC, the campaign arm for Senate Republicans, from 2009 to 2013. Before joining the Senate, he was Texas' attorney general.
..... He also condemned Trump's actions on January 6 [2021] and later said he didn't think Trump could win another presidential race. However, he endorsed Trump's reelection bid in January of this year. [2024]
..... Cornyn had less bad blood with Trump to begin with but has also worked to endear himself to Trump since then. He spent time on the Campaign trail with Trump in Texas and Nevada, and also visited Mar-a-Lago to speak with Trump during the campaign.
..... He has one public endorsement so far: Sean tor Josh Hawley R-Montana.
..... Scott, 71. just won a second term in the Senate. He was first elected in 2019 after serving as the governor of Florida, where he initially forged a relationship with Trump.
..... He has led a small cohort of Republic Senators who oppose McConnell and align more closely with Trump. in 2022, he challenged McConnell for the leadership position, losing 37-10. Some of his colleagues remain frustrate with GOP losses under his leadership as NRSC chair during the 2022 elections.
..... Scott has touted his close relationship with Trump as he campaigns for the leadership spot. He has noted that Trump's incoming chief of staff, Susie Wiles, ran his gubernatorial campaign, creating an immediate connection with the next White House.
..... "We have got to change the way the Senate is run to get Trump's agenda done," Scott said on Fox News on Sunday. [11/10/2024] "so the question is going to be: Who is going to make sure we get these things done?"
..... He has the endorsement of Sean tors Tommy Tuberville, R-Alabama,; Marco Rubio, R-Florida; Bill Hagerty, R-Tennessee; and Rand Paul R- Kentucky.
